Latest Patents
José Miguel holds a patent for a detection method that includes a detection system comprising a detection device and an assay device. The detection device is designed with a space for receiving the assay device, a drive arrangement that engages the assay device to facilitate its rotation, and a light source that directs light towards the assay device. Additionally, a diffuser is strategically placed between the light source and the space to diffuse the light effectively. The detection device also features a light receiver that captures light that has passed through the assay device. This innovative approach enhances the accuracy and efficiency of detection processes.
